From patchwork Thu May 11 14:07:41 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jun Nie X-Patchwork-Id: 495 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 5AC0CC7EE23 for ; Thu, 11 May 2023 14:05:56 +0000 (UTC) Received: from mail-pj1-f49.google.com (mail-pj1-f49.google.com [209.85.216.49]) by mx.groups.io with SMTP id smtpd.web11.59852.1683813949154268311 for ; Thu, 11 May 2023 07:05:49 -0700 Authentication-Results: mx.groups.io; dkim=fail reason="signature has expired" header.i=@linaro.org header.s=google header.b=kBKckfBo; spf=pass (domain: linaro.org, ip: 209.85.216.49, mailfrom: jun.nie@linaro.org) Received: by mail-pj1-f49.google.com with SMTP id 98e67ed59e1d1-250252e4113so5722838a91.0 for ; Thu, 11 May 2023 07:05:49 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; t=1683813948; x=1686405948;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=2ZzYBChk+Y+4FnTAnhrjmA1kZp161oQ438DA4o/vhqg=; b=kBKckfBoUDPXxiE8MP3hW8qldzjKiXRJVFwX3ykv1tc/l49TYUPAEQl8XO1HfPcj4l PXGuV7ZjJb7mz1a2Ahi33uBdsok+QNQvlvKweMaP/BKllomMdYQL8WrGQDCHAOioOJCb nBKPAOGUjZznwspxKlNl55X7J7+AeoqCuyiaCjkMU027egl005kwZSPLqYFdvUHSVDxz oBz39l4T3rUaBwMeXn3UYJvh5A45hQrYqBAoo1yMKqVQIQcaYbub0SgLrHYfuQKK2D0a 3jyC37dgYaJvXNhXOYN1b0agYW+cdTvMZ0c0vN3wT012kqNZkVzSzPuLU2AAwjm1o2+n G4CQ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1683813948; x=1686405948;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=2ZzYBChk+Y+4FnTAnhrjmA1kZp161oQ438DA4o/vhqg=; b=bVtCN/gu3rawxc+DvZRZsii55rPRwtDw7it6GWrtyx299ISK7b+OBTSN7nZMuQWled a/iCZudXEuQXq443yptfNA6+DZ9LbPmGEVKwT5wIkVKH/xKkK7VlGpJUgT9ZIls+Waa8 0OVHtc+ybnHHzZvE3kFaJ6gZgxAhv5szgD9N2pp52xFkj9UlRr9PAchSkDi5pEpHJUdJ kfFnkCK6hpKC9GhsLG+ZWP4yVS3gd/TS/zMC1egxd0syR4iHW+pPdpQFwM1nqfuuE4jy IL6m1sMnXMIVJldS7stTgtLOFsAIexm5bJw/dwIfzrXx3i9QMaQzfmXNMMxH8vtobjEA K1PQ== X-Gm-Message-State: AC+VfDz5ZmS/Jz4HShAlpqBzO3kni+oVs1mzit94DmYRPE2/mDwYtB8U iATLPlCl4vFYNh+W7fQJ149TFg== X-Google-Smtp-Source: ACHHUZ61/jdUB0Dp3JJOWvTtcsc5r7NJcFLUvrCqt1teRoHDX92pnsmumMlGKWAvycAhuGv93AEJvg== X-Received: by 2002:a17:90b:3881:b0:24e:109a:94e with SMTP id mu1-20020a17090b388100b0024e109a094emr21315449pjb.7.1683813948535; Thu, 11 May 2023 07:05:48 -0700 (PDT) Received: from niej-dt-7B47.. (80.251.214.228.16clouds.com. [80.251.214.228]) by smtp.gmail.com with ESMTPSA id m3-20020a63fd43000000b0051b36aee4f6sm5033731pgj.83.2023.05.11.07.05.43 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 11 May 2023 07:05:47 -0700 (PDT) From: Jun Nie To: richard@hughsie.com, raj.khem@gmail.com Cc: openembedded-devel@lists.openembedded.org, Jun Nie Subject: [meta-oe][PATCH v2 0/3] Add necessary lib and python tool to handle CoSWID tag Date: Thu, 11 May 2023 22:07:41 +0800 Message-Id: <20230511140744.2918627-1-jun.nie@linaro.org>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 11 May 2023 14:05:56 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-devel/message/102541 Software Identification (SWID) tags provide an extensible XML-based structure to identify and describe individual software components, patches, and installation bundles. CoSWID supports a similar set of semantics and features as SWID tags, as well as new semantics that allow us to describe additional types of information, all in a more memory efficient format. Changes vs V1: - fix libcbor cmake flag and rename recipe with version - fix python3-pefile SRC_URI sha value Jun Nie (3): libcbor: Add initial support python3-pefile: Add initial support python3-uswid: Add initial support .../recipes-extended/libcbor/libcbor_0.10.2.bb | 14 ++++++++++++++ .../python/python3-pefile_2023.2.7.bb | 13 +++++++++++++ .../recipes-devtools/python/python3-uswid_git.bb | 15 +++++++++++++++ 3 files changed, 42 insertions(+) create mode 100755 meta-oe/recipes-extended/libcbor/libcbor_0.10.2.bb create mode 100644 meta-python/recipes-devtools/python/python3-pefile_2023.2.7.bb create mode 100644 meta-python/recipes-devtools/python/python3-uswid_git.bb